Whatnot is a live stream platform and marketplace headquartered in Venice, Los Angeles, CA, that enables users to turn their passions into businesses. Whatnot is seeking a Senior Compensation Business Partner / Lead to guide compensation strategy across Engineering, Product, and Design. You'll collaborate with senior leaders to design frameworks that balance competitiveness and equity. This role requires strong analytical capabilities and strategic depth.
